run off at the mouth AmE informalto talk too much喋喋不休 run off at the mouth N. Amer. informal talk excessively or indiscreetly 〈北美, 非正式〉信口开河, 夸夸其谈。 run off at the mouth〈俚语〉夸夸其谈;信口开河:Ivan was born with some eloquence,he ran off at the mouth wherever he went,people all looked at him in surprise.艾凡生来就有些口才,他所到之处就夸夸其谈,大家都惊讶地望着他。 |
